Energy efficiency
An old refrigerator can be expensive to run. Replace an old refrigerator with a new energy-efficient model to cut down on your electric bill. Utilize the Flip Your Fridge Calculator to find out the amount your current fridge is costing you and find out about the savings you could make with the purchase of a new, ENERGY STAR-certified fridge.
Many refrigerators that are ENERGY-STAR certified have features such as automatic icemakers or through-the-door ice dispensers. These features help keep the fridge at a stable temperature, but they can also boost the appliance's energy consumption by 14-20 percent, so be sure to be aware of this when comparing fridges.
Refrigerators have improved their efficiency through the years thanks to federal efficiency standards. Energy-saving fridges and freezers can save you hundreds of dollars in electricity bills over the life of their older models. Modern refrigerators consume less power and lower greenhouse gas emissions.
Manufacturers are gradually switching over to a refrigerant known as R600a, which isn't a hydrofluorocarbon (HFC) and doesn't deplete the ozone layer. It is flammable, so it is important to handle it with care. Be sure to check the warranty of your fridge prior to purchasing it, and then read on how to handle this new refrigerant.
Whether your new fridge uses R134a or a different type of refrigeration fluid, it must remain ENERGY Certified STAR. You can determine the energy efficiency rating by looking at the energy label sale on fridge freezers uk the appliance. The energy label will show you the appliance's annual energy consumption in kWh and compare it with other refrigerators with similar capacity.
The most efficient way to get most energy efficiency from your fridge is to make sure you don't overfill it with food. A full fridge uses more energy than a half-full fridge to keep it at a temperature. Therefore, only keep the amount of food you'll require. This can also decrease the number of times you open and close the fridge, which could impact the appliance's ability to maintain a constant temperature. The more often you open and close the fridge, the more energy it needs to cool down everything.
